Smoking prevalence increased continuously over the review period, mainly as a result of growing demand among the younger population for tobacco products, especially cigarettes and traditional water pipes. An increase in the number of female smokers was also a trend over the review period. Many young Iranian women began to consider smoking as a fashionable way of relaxing. The Iranian authorities announced that the consumption pattern of tobacco products has changed towards younger consumers, which was possibly a consequence of the limited awareness about the harmful effects of these products, as well as the improved availability of multinational cigarette brands.
